Lil Baby Drops Music Video for “Pop Out” With Nardo Wick

Lil Baby has dropped the music video for his track “Pop Out” featuring Nardo Wick. The hip-hop/rap cut made its debut on Lil Baby’s third studio album, It’s Only Me, which was released on October 14, 2022. Marking the second time Lil Baby and Nardo Wick have collaborated, the newly released music video brings the success-laden track to life. As Lil Baby raps about his accomplishments in life, he’s seen in a range of shots including riding around in a Maybach, sitting with his two sons, hanging with his crew and more. “I’m the type of guy ready to die for this sh*t if it gon’ prevail us/I can’t slip, look at this sh*t I’ve built, I know they tryna nail us,” raps Lil Baby. Watch Roddy Ricch Freestyle Over Jay-Z’s “I Just Wanna Love U”

Following the debut of his latest album Feed Tha Streets III, Roddy Ricch headed to Funkmaster Flex’s Hot 97 radio segment to deliver his take on a quick freestyle. The Compton rapper delivered the new installment in his Feed Tha Streets LP series earlier this month, with features from Lil Durk and Ty Dolla $ign. Just a few days ago, he followed up on the release with a music video for his Durk collaboration, “Twin.” On Hot 97, Ricch rapped over the instrumental of Jay-Z’s iconic 2000 single, “I Just Wanna Love U (Give It 2 Me),” which was produced by The Neptunes. Ricch uses the laid-back beat to drop bars about a recurring theme in his discography: flexing how far he’s come and how much money he’s made. Machine Gun Kelly Delivers Title Track From Semi-Autobiographical Film ‘Taurus’

Machine Gun Kelly has dropped off a new track, titled “Taurus,” featuring Naomi Wild. The single, which arrives with a music video, is the feature song from the major motion picture Taurus, in which Kelly stars under his real name, Colson Baker. In the semi-autobiographical film named after Baker’s astrological birth sign, the musician-turned-actor depicts an emerging, troubled musician desperately attempting to record a hit song, while struggling to deal with the mounting pressures of fame and addiction. Listen to i_o’s Stunning Posthumous Album, a Reminder of the Fragility of Life

Two years after the tragic death of i_o, the family of the late DJ and electronic music producer has released a posthumous album, Warehouse Summer. The album is a stunning snapshot not only of i_o’s enduring legacy, but also how much more he had to accomplish. It’s both a reminder of the fragility of life and a captivating cry for help in the throes of collective mourning. Warehouse Summer features 14 new tracks, each of which features alt-pop star Lights, a frequent collaborator of the techno virtuoso. Here’s How to Unlock a Secret Daft Punk Helmet In “Pokémon Scarlet and Violet”

While most of the world is out chasing Pikachu and other creatures in the Pokédex, electronic music fans should have their eyes on a different prize. Last weekend, the gaming world celebrated the launch of Pokémon Scarlet and Violet, the ninth generation of the iconic Pokémon game series. There are over 400 monsters to collect and battle, but perhaps the most unique haul comes in the form of a secretive clothing item from the Daft Punk universe. Players can equip their trainer with a robot helmet similar to the one worn by Daft Punk’s Guy-Manuel de Homem-Christo, and unlocking it is actually quite simple. Union Urges Music Venues and Festivals to Stop Cutting Into Artists’ Merchandise Sales

A lot is expected from musicians, but nobody wants to pay for it. That includes music venues and festivals. The Union of Musicians and Allied Workers (UMAW), known for their steadfast campaigns against Spotify, are pushing venues and music festivals to stop taking percentages of musicians’ merchandise sales. The campaign, dubbed “#MyMerch,” has brought in the Featured Artists Coalition (FAC) and Canadian rapper Cadence Weapon to assist. It comes after a successful campaign in the U.K. that FAC completed earlier this year. The pandemic tested every sector of the music industry, especially the live music space—but artists still seem to get the short end of the stick. deadmau5 Inks First-Ever Liquor Endorsement

deadmau5 has inked a deal with CoCo Vodka, a brand of hard coconut water, for his first-ever liquor endorsement. Brian Eno Remixes Patti Smith and Soundwalk Collective’s “Peradam”: Listen

Soundwalk Collective with Patti Smith have announced a deluxe box set reissuing three of their albums: The Peyote Dance, Mummer Love, and Peradam. The collection also includes a seven-track remix record called The Perfect Vision: Reworkings. The remix album will include new interpretations by Brian Eno, Jim Jarmusch, Laraaji, Kaitlyn Aurelia Smith, and more. The deluxe release arrives November 25 via Bella Union.
